We Do It All

Managing a construction job involves several key steps

Planning

Design and Engineering

Design and Engineering

 Define project goals, set a budget, create a timeline, and establish  clear objectives. Conduct thorough site assessments and feasibility  studies to identify any potential challenges or opportunities. 

Design and Engineering

Design and Engineering

Design and Engineering

 Collaborate with architects, designers, and engineers to develop  detailed plans, blueprints, and specifications for the project. Ensure  all necessary permits and approvals are obtained. 

Procurement

Design and Engineering

Construction

 Source and procure materials, equipment, and subcontractors based on  project requirements and specifications. Obtain competitive bids and  negotiate contracts. 

Construction

Communication and Documentation

Construction

 Execute the project according to the established plans and timeline.  Monitor progress, manage resources, and ensure compliance with safety  regulations. Regularly communicate with the construction team and  address any issues or changes that arise. 

Quality Control

Communication and Documentation

Communication and Documentation

 Conduct regular inspections and quality checks to ensure that the  construction meets the specified standards and requirements. Address any  deficiencies promptly and implement corrective measures. 

Communication and Documentation

Communication and Documentation

Communication and Documentation

 Maintain clear and open communication with stakeholders, including the  client, subcontractors, suppliers, and regulatory authorities. Document  all project activities, changes, and approvals to ensure transparency  and accountability. 

Project Management

Completion and Handover

Completion and Handover

  Oversee the overall project, monitor budget and expenses, and adjust  plans as necessary. Coordinate with all parties involved to maintain  project momentum and resolve any conflicts or challenges that may arise. 

Completion and Handover

Completion and Handover

Completion and Handover

  Conduct final inspections, ensure all necessary inspections and permits  are obtained, and address any outstanding issues. Prepare the project  for handover to the client, including all necessary documentation,  training, and warranties.
